From Argentina: Garnacho, knee problems. Scaloni leaves him at home, listening to United

Another one out. The plague of injuries is spreading across the Old Continent close to the commitments with the national team scheduled for the October window, but also overseas. In fact, even theArgentina by Lionel Scaloni continues to accumulate important absences a few days before the new double date of the South American qualifiers against Venezuela and Bolivia.

Garnacho is also out
In addition to Paulo Dybala, Nicolas Gonzalez and Marcos Acuna, all due to physical problems, in the last minutes – according to information reported by TyC Sports – the absence of was also confirmed Alejandro Garnacho. The Manchester United left winger, currently in England, will not join the Albiceleste in training camp in Miami according to the directives of the coach himself. For a few days the 2004 class has been suffering from knee problems and the Red Devils’ medical staff – we read – advised him not to take risks with the national team and to take advantage of the break to rest and recover.

In addition to United’s warm suggestion, however, Scaloni also made some reflections, understanding that having Garnacho below 100% fitness would be more of a problem than a solution, especially in the long term. Hence the final decision to exclude the player from the squad list and to urgently call up another attacker.
